Help us improve your experience.

Let us know what you think.

Do you have time for a two-minute survey?

 
 

NETCONF を使用して設定オブジェクトの特定の子タグをリクエストする

Junos OS を実行しているデバイスとの NETCONF セッションでは、設定オブジェクトに対して特定の子タグ要素と子孫を要求するために、クライアント アプリケーションは、ルート(タグ要素で<configuration>表される)からオブジェクトの直接の親レベルまで、設定階層のすべてのレベルを表すタグ要素を囲むタグ要素を発行<filter>します。要求されたオブジェクトを表すために、アプリケーションはコンテナ タグ要素を発行します。特定の構成オブジェクトを要求するには、identifierタグ要素を含めます。単一の識別子を持つオブジェクトの場合、実際の<name>識別子タグ要素の名前が異なる場合でも、タグ要素を常に使用できます。実際の名前も有効です。複数の識別子を持つオブジェクトの場合、識別子タグ要素の実際の名前を使用する必要があります。識別子タグ要素を省略した場合、サーバーはその型のすべての構成オブジェクトの子タグを返します。クライアント アプリケーションは、特定の子タグを選択するために、必要なすべての子タグ要素とコンテナー タグ要素内の子孫を発行します。リクエスト全体がタグ要素で<rpc>囲まれています。

タグ要素の <source> 詳細については、 NETCONF を使用した構成情報リクエストのソースの指定を参照してください。

NETCONF サーバーは、 内 <data> のオブジェクトと <rpc-reply> タグ要素(ここでは、識別子タグ要素が呼び出 <name>)されるオブジェクト)の要求された子を返します。開始 <configuration> タグの属性については、 NETCONF を使用した設定情報リクエストのソースの指定を参照してください。

アプリケーションは、同じタグ要素に適切なタグ要素を含めることで、同じまたは他のタイプの追加構成要素を <get-config> 要求することもできます。詳細については、 NETCONF を使用して複数の構成要素を同時にリクエストするを参照してください。

以下の例では、候補設定の 階層レベルで [edit routing-options static] 192.168.5.0/24 ルートのネクストホップ デバイスのアドレスのみを要求する方法を示しています。

以下の例では、候補設定のグループ階層レベル内の各物理インターフェイスに設定されたすべての論理インターフェイスのアドレスを要求する方法を示しています。